Tip #1: Run a background check

You need to know all you can about the website that you want to get online streaming services from. Luckily, the internet is full of places where you can get information on the legitimacy of a company, its quality of service and its reliability.

Granted, you need to take some of the comments with a grain of salt, but looking through reliable technology sites can give you a good picture of what the company is like before you give them your money.

Tip#2: Ensure the security of your information

Most of the good online streaming services require some payment in the form of subscriptions or registration fees. This is alright because more often than not, it means you are getting quality services.

The thing to look out for here is the security of your personal and bank information when making payments. The internet is a dangerous place and you can have your information stolen along with all your cash if their systems are insecure. Be sure to ask about this before you make the payment.

Tip#3: Check the rate of their downtime

This information can be found when running the background check on the company website and directly from sales people. Paying for services that an unavailable 50% of the time is a classic waste of money so be sure to check on that before ‘signing on the dotted line’.

This can also apply for your ISP. Companies like Charter Communications have clear information about downtime so all you have to do is ask.

Tip#4: Personal accounts are a necessity

The advantage of having a personal account within the streaming service is that it is much easier for you to stream videos and create playlists which enable you to know what you have and haven’t watched. It seems like a simple convenience, but it is critical so make it a requirement of your service provider.

Tip#5: Check your internet connection

Regardless of how much effort you put in making sure your online streaming service provider is on point, it means nothing if your internet connection is not up to par. Its speed level has to match that of the streaming service. It has to be strong and stable, and not have too many devices working it thereby slowing it down.
